Summary

This study uses advanced brain scans (PET and MRI) to examine serotonin activity in people with Parkinson's disease. Researchers will compare brain images from 42 participants at different stages of the disease. The goal is to find biological markers that could lead to new treatments to slow the condition.

What this could lead to
If successful, this could help identify brain changes that lead to new medications to slow Parkinson's progression.
What could go wrong
This is an early observational study with only 42 participants, so findings may not apply to everyone. It does not test a treatment.
